MSc in Finance

MSc in Finance is a programme that provides you with a strong generalist foundation in finance. It is structured to provide a strategic perspective on finance and investments, and is designed to help students establish some autonomy over the content of their degree. Students are encouraged to pursue their own interests for career and business development by choosing from a number of elective modules.

Part One of the MSc in Finance programme consists of four core modules and two elective modules of your choice. Part two of the programme is a a research project which includes a dissertation.
